Gustin jeans made from sanforized raw selvedge denim from one of the finest mills in Japan. There are so many elements a mill can play with to create a special denim. Some of our favorites involve using special wefts. This example shows you why. This is the type of denim that at first glance has very classic roots. It's a solid 13.5 ounces. Nice starch lends it a true raw denim feel. A deep indigo warp is where we love all our blue denim to start. The weft now takes over to make this denim much more special. It's all cotton and dyed to a super bright cobalt blue. Of course you can see it if you choose to cuff your denim, but it makes its presence known in other ways. Instead of a classic white grain showing through the top surface you see this subtle blue glow. It's almost like a colorful shadow in the base of the fabric. It really makes the denim. These are the cool finds that keep us loving the world of selvedge denim.
